Timezone in Sherborne St John
Sherborne St John is located in the Europe/London timezone, which operates on a UTC offset of +0 hours during standard time. When daylight saving time is in effect, typically from the last Sunday in March to the last Sunday in October, the offset changes to UTC +1 hour. This shift means that clocks are set forward one hour in spring and back one hour in autumn.
When considering the time difference with the United States, it varies significantly across the country. For example, New York operates on UTC -5 hours during standard time, meaning there is a five-hour difference when Sherborne St John is on standard time, and a six-hour difference when Sherborne St John observes daylight saving time. Attractions and Activities in Sherborne St John
Sherborne St John is a village located in Hampshire, England, known for its picturesque countryside and tranquil environment. The village is characterized by its charming residential areas and historic architecture, which reflect the rich history of the region. Surrounded by beautiful landscapes, it offers a peaceful retreat for those seeking to enjoy rural life.
The area is part of the larger Basingstoke and Deane district, which features a mix of urban and rural settings. While Sherborne St John itself may not have a plethora of tourist attractions, it is close to Basingstoke, where visitors can explore the Milestones Museum and the Anvil concert hall. The nearby North Wessex Downs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ty provides opportunities for outdoor activities such as walking and cycling, showcasing the natural beauty of the Hampshire countryside.
